THERE IS SNOW
so kinda a lazy day start - nice breakfast garlic eggs - got on the trail little after noon. Great conditions 40's no wind 100% visibility.
The start of the trail was clear: no snow and minimal water trickling down.
I was intending to go over to Flume and have a little fun climbing up the slide, but I was jogging the "approach" and ran right past the cut offoppsi.
Anyways, after 1 - 1.5 miles in a little dusting of snow, perhaps 3000' ? But no concern nor need for any spikes, defintley not any need for double plastic YET ; )
Up by the tent camps the trail became mostly snow but very minimal 1-2' so again regular boots still fine
I reached the summit of Liberty in under 2 hours to find great views! Visibility just amazing!!! Pretty comfortable up there maybe 10-20 knt winds with 25-30 F so I just sat there in a polypro and eat a couple of cliff bars. Back down to the car very quickly with a light jog... all in all round trip maybe 3 - 3.5 hours for 8 miles roundtrip with maybe 3000' elevation gain? Not a bad afternoon of exercises
